すべてのプロダクト
Search
ドキュメントセンター

Simple Log Service:ログがOSSに送信されない場合はどうすればよいですか?

最終更新日:Oct 23, 2024

このトピックでは、ログがObject Storage Service (OSS) に送信されない問題を解決する手順について説明します。

エンドポイントエラー

症状

AccessDenied: The bucket you are attempting to access must be addressed using the specified endpoint. Please send all future requests to this endpoint.

原因

エラーメッセージは、Simple Log ServiceプロジェクトとOSSバケットのリージョン間の不一致を示します。

解決策

Simple Log ServiceプロジェクトとOSSバケットが同じリージョンにあることを確認します。 詳細については、「エンドポイント」をご参照ください。

RAMロールが存在しません

症状

EntityNotExist.Role: The role does not exist:

原因

エラーメッセージは、RAMロールが存在しないことを示します。 これは、誤ったAlibaba Cloudリソース名 (ARN) が原因である可能性があります。

解決策

正しいARNを指定します。 詳細については、「」をご参照ください。RAMロールのARNを取得するにはどうすればよいですか?

オブジェクトアクセス権なし

現象

You have no right to access this object because of bucket ACL.

原因

エラーメッセージは、オブジェクトへのアクセス権限が不十分であることを示します。 これは、Simple Log Serviceの書き込み操作を制限するOSSバケットのアクセス制御リスト (ACL) ポリシー設定が原因です。

解決策

OSS配信タスクをスムーズに実行するには、ACLポリシーを調整して必要なアクセス権限を付与します。 詳細は、「アクセス制御の概要」をご参照ください。